Important differences between tart and green beans

  • Tart has more vitamin B2, iron, vitamin B6, selenium, vitamin B3, vitamin B1, folate, and phosphorus; however, green beans have more vitamin K.
  • Green beans' daily need coverage for vitamin K is 40% more.
  • Tart has 361 times more sodium than green beans. Tart has 361mg of sodium, while green beans have 1mg.
  • Tart has a higher glycemic index than green beans.

The food varieties used in the comparison are Breakfast tart, low fat and Beans, snap, green, cooked, boiled, drained, without salt.
